What information do I need to match these pistons to my engine?
You need the engine code, bore size, stroke, rod length, pin diameter and target compression ratio. These determine the correct piston compression height and crown design.
How should ring gaps be set for these pistons?
Ring gaps must be set by your engine builder based on fuel type, boost level and the intended rpm range. Forced-induction engines usually require larger gaps.
Are forged pistons suitable for street engines?
Yes. Forged pistons handle detonation and high cylinder pressure better than cast units. Your builder should set the piston-to-bore clearance to suit your application.
What is the recommended bore clearance for the BBCRE5330-030 pistons?
For the BBCRE5330-030 pistons, a typical bore clearance of 0.0030" to 0.0035" is recommended. However, always verify with your engine builder as clearances may vary based on specific engine conditions and intended use.
What compression ratio can I expect with the BBCRE5330-030 pistons?
The BBCRE5330-030 pistons are designed to achieve a compression ratio of approximately 14.3:1 when used with 118cc cylinder heads. Ensure your engine is properly tuned to handle this compression for optimal performance.
Do the BBCRE5330-030 pistons require any specific machining?
Yes, the BBCRE5330-030 pistons may require precise machining for proper fitment, including checking and potentially honing the bore. Additionally, ensure the ring grooves are clean and properly sized for the rings provided.
What type of fuel is recommended for use with the BBCRE5330-030 pistons?
Given the high compression ratio of 14.3:1, it is recommended to use high-octane fuel, such as 98 RON or higher, to prevent detonation and ensure reliable performance.
What is the weight of the BBCRE5330-030 pistons and how does it affect engine balance?
The BBCRE5330-030 pistons weigh 623 grams each. It's important to consider this weight in relation to the entire rotating assembly to maintain proper engine balance. Ensure the crankshaft and conrods are matched accordingly.
